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 11-05-2005, 23:22   #1 (permalink)
Neuer User
 
Registriert seit: Aug 2004
Beiträge: 15
Question Dynamische Schlüsselbildernamen vergeben?

Hallo,

ich möchte eine Flaschdatei mit gotoAndStop("bild_"+i)
steuern. Das i ist eine Variable. Bei jeden Sprung nach vorne
i++ bzw. Sprung nach hinten i--.

Mein Prob:
Ist es möglich die passenden Schlüsselbildernamen dünamisch zu erstellen?
Wenn ich 10 sprünge machen will dann brauche ich 10 Schlüsselbilder
mit den Namen: bild_1, bild_2, ....bild_i..., bild_10
Währe es möglich jedes Schlüsselbild mit "bild_"+i zu bennen wobei i eine
Variable die im meinem Bsp. von 1 bis 10 durchläuft ist?

DANKE!
Surfer_1981 ist offline   Mit Zitat antworten
Alt 12-05-2005, 00:08   #2 (permalink)
voidboy
 
Benutzerbild von rendner[i]
 
Registriert seit: Sep 2004
Ort: München
Beiträge: 5.588
Nein Du kannst von Flash nicht die Schlüsselbilder benennen lassen.
Braucht man doch auch nicht, wenn Du zum 2ten Bild (Frame) gehen willst reicht doch auch ein:
PHP-Code:
// i muss dann natürlich 2 sein
gotoAndStop); 
__________________
ERROR: Signature is too large
rendner[i] ist offline   Mit Zitat antworten
Alt 12-05-2005, 01:15   #3 (permalink)
brand new user
 
Benutzerbild von RustyCake
 
Registriert seit: May 2002
Ort: Laimbach 6 1/2
Beiträge: 16.884
Geht doch Easy mit "nextFrame & prevFrame"!!
ActionScript:
  1. stop();
  2. vor_btn.onPress = function() {
  3.     _root.gotoAndStop(nextFrame());
  4. };
  5. zurück_btn.onPress = function() {
  6.     _root.gotoAndStop(prevFrame());
  7. };
Angehängte Dateien
Dateityp: zip vor_zurueck.zip (4,1 KB, 0x aufgerufen)
__________________
Bitte keine Fragen, zu Flash per PM. Dazu ist das Forum da. Danke MFG_RustyCake!
"Wer tanzen will, muß erst gehen lernen"
RustyCake ist offline   Mit Zitat antworten
Alt 13-05-2005, 10:13   #4 (permalink)
Neuer User
 
Registriert seit: Aug 2004
Beiträge: 15
danke für die schnelle Antwort,

Zitat:
Geht doch Easy mit "nextFrame & prevFrame"!!
Die funktion kenne ich, aber diese bringt mich nicht weiter da ich immer um mehr als ein Bild weiterspringen möchte. Deshalb bennen ich die Schlüsselbilder zu denen ich springen möchte mit bild_1; bild_2; bild_3 usw
Wenn ich aber nachträglich zwischen bild_1 und bild_2 einen "Haltepunkt" einfügen möchte muss ich den bild_2 nenen und alle daruf folgenden ändern
-> aus bild_2 wird bild_3; aus bild_4 wird bild_4 usw.
Das ist viel Arbeit und mein Problem.
Surfer_1981 ist offline   Mit Zitat antworten
Alt 13-05-2005, 10:53   #5 (permalink)
voidboy
 
Benutzerbild von rendner[i]
 
Registriert seit: Sep 2004
Ort: München
Beiträge: 5.588
Dann speichere Dir doch die Framenummern in einem Array und dann kannst Du dort die richtige Framenummer auslesen.
Bsp.:
PHP-Code:
var arr_frameNumber = [ 102545505872 ];
var 
0// um in Frame 10 zu springen = bild1

gotoAndStoparr_frameNumber[ ++] );    //springt in Frame 25 = bild2 
__________________
ERROR: Signature is too large
rendner[i] 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 05:16 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ele